
At the American Le Mans Series (ALMS) winter tests which 28 Jan, the long distance race car, which received modifications in many areas, immediately displayed its exceptional reliability and handling. Porsche teams Flying Lizard Motorsports and Farnbacher Loles Racing conducted an intensive three-day test schedule and worked on a base setup for the Mobil 1 Twelve Hours of Sebring, which will be held on Saturday, March 21.

In Sebring with a 2008 GT3 RSR, the VICI Racing squad concentrated on setup tests with the Michelin tires, which are new for the team. By the Sebring race next month, the outfit will also run the 450 hp Porsche 911 GT3 RSR with the new four-liter six-cylinder boxer engine.
